黑狐家游戏

关系数据库是什么的集合,数据库是什么的集合

欧气 1 0

《深入理解关系数据库:数据的集合及其背后的奥秘》

在当今数字化的时代,数据无处不在,而关系数据库作为管理数据的重要工具,扮演着极为关键的角色,关系数据库是相关数据的集合。

一、关系数据库的基本结构与数据的组织形式

关系数据库以表(Table)为基本的数据存储单元,这些表由行(Row)和列(Column)组成,每一行代表一个实体的实例,例如在一个学生信息表中,每一行可能就代表着一个学生的具体信息;而每一列则表示实体的某个属性,像学生表中的姓名列、年龄列、学号列等,这种结构就像一个精心设计的表格,将各种数据有序地排列起来。

关系数据库是什么的集合,数据库是什么的集合

图片来源于网络,如有侵权联系删除

不同的表之间通过关系(Relationship)相互连接,关系可以是一对一、一对多或者多对多的关系,以学校的数据库为例,学生表和课程表之间存在着多对多的关系,一个学生可以选修多门课程,而一门课程也可以被多个学生选修,通过建立关系,关系数据库能够避免数据的冗余存储,提高数据的完整性和一致性。

二、数据的集合体现——数据的存储与关联

关系数据库中的数据集合不仅仅是简单的表格堆积,数据的存储是按照一定的规则和策略进行的,数据库管理系统会为每个表分配存储空间,并且根据数据类型来优化存储方式,对于数值型数据,可能会采用特定的二进制格式存储以节省空间并提高计算效率;对于字符型数据,则需要考虑编码方式等因素。

在关联方面,关系数据库利用主键(Primary Key)和外键(Foreign Key)来建立表之间的联系,主键是表中用于唯一标识每一行数据的列或列组合,外键则是一个表中的列,它引用了另一个表中的主键,这种关联机制使得数据在不同表之间能够有效地交互,在一个订单管理系统中,订单表中的客户ID列作为外键关联到客户表的主键,这样就可以方便地查询某个订单对应的客户信息,包括客户的姓名、地址等。

三、关系数据库中的数据完整性约束与数据集合的质量保障

关系数据库是什么的集合,数据库是什么的集合

图片来源于网络,如有侵权联系删除

关系数据库通过一系列的数据完整性约束来确保数据集合的质量,实体完整性要求表中的每一行都有一个唯一的主键,这就保证了数据的唯一性,在员工信息表中,员工编号作为主键,每个员工都有一个唯一的编号,不会出现两个员工具有相同编号的情况。

参照完整性则规定了外键的值必须是另一个表中主键的有效值或者为空,这防止了数据的不一致性,比如在上述订单管理系统中,订单表中的客户ID必须是客户表中存在的有效客户ID,否则就会破坏数据的逻辑关系。

还有域完整性,它确保列中的数据满足特定的数据类型和取值范围,年龄列的数据应该是合理的数值范围,不能出现负数或者过大不合理的值。

四、关系数据库在实际应用中的数据集合操作与意义

在实际应用场景中,关系数据库的数据集合操作十分丰富,查询操作是最常见的操作之一,通过SQL(结构化查询语言)可以从数据库的多个表中提取所需的数据,在一个电商平台的数据库中,可以查询某个用户购买过的所有商品信息,这可能涉及到用户表、订单表、订单商品表等多个表的关联查询。

关系数据库是什么的集合,数据库是什么的集合

图片来源于网络,如有侵权联系删除

插入、更新和删除操作也是关系数据库管理数据集合的重要手段,当有新的用户注册时,就需要向用户表中插入新的用户数据;当用户修改自己的信息时,就会涉及到对用户表中相应数据的更新;而当用户注销账号时,则需要从相关表中删除其数据。

关系数据库的数据集合对于企业和组织来说具有巨大的意义,它能够有效地管理海量的数据,为决策提供准确的数据支持,企业可以通过分析销售数据库中的数据集合,了解不同产品的销售趋势、客户的购买偏好等,从而制定合理的营销策略,关系数据库也保障了数据的安全性和可靠性,通过用户权限管理、数据备份恢复等机制,保护数据集合免受非法访问和数据丢失的风险。

关系数据库作为数据的集合,其结构、存储、关联、完整性约束以及实际应用操作等方面都有着丰富的内涵和重要的意义,它是现代信息技术领域中不可或缺的一部分,不断推动着各个行业的数字化发展进程。

标签: #关系数据库 #数据库 #集合 #概念

黑狐家游戏
  • 评论列表

留言评论